Rockstar loves hiding easter eggs in its games, especially when it comes to theGrand Theft Autofranchise.Grand Theft Auto 5is certainly no exception, with the open world packed with easter eggs - some of which have taken years for fans to discover. Now Reddit user ShaolinManuelMiranda believes they’ve found yet another easter egg inGrand Theft Auto 5six years removed from the game’s original release, and it’s a possible reference to the events of Rockstar’s most recent game,Red Dead Redemption 2. Reddit user ShaolinManuelMiranda found a park inGrand Theft Auto 5’s open world called Arthur’s Pass Trails. Some have interpreted the name of this park to be possible foreshadowing of the events inRed Dead Redemption 2, as they pertain to main character Arthur Morgan. As those who have played through all ofRed Dead Redemption 2will know, Arthur doesn’t exactly make it through the game alive, hence “Arthur’sPassTrails.”
Of course, it’s possible that this is just a coincidence, butRed Dead Redemption 2did technically start development near the end ofGTA 5’s development cycle. It’s possible that Rockstar had already ironed the details of the game’s story and knew that it was going tokill Arthur from tuberculosis, and so the developers decided to sneak in this reference to his death inGrand Theft Auto 5.
Whether or not this is an intentional reference toRed Dead Redemption 2is up for debate. But withGrand Theft Auto 5already having so many easter eggs, it’s not hard to believe that this could very well be another one.
Besides this possibleRed Dead Redemption 2reference, there are many other notableGrand Theft Auto 5easter eggs. For example, players can visit Grove Street fromGrand Theft Auto: San Andreas, as well as find UFOs flying in the sky throughout the open world. And given the sheer size ofGrand Theft Auto 5and its open world, it’s not out of the realm of possibility that even more easter eggs are still hidden in the game, yet to be discovered.
